Subject: Master Copies — Print Run Collection

Dispatch: the master copies for the Larkfield catalogue run go out to Quillstone Print today. Four sealed tubes plus one proof binder, all on the staging rack by bay two. Shift lead signs them out; nothing leaves without the manifest countersigned. Courier booked for the 14:00 slot. Tubes must not be bent or stacked. Confirm collection back to me once the van departs. The confidential hand-over instruction for the courier is below.

handover note for yagef-bagep: the drudor pelius courier leaves the kasdor zorvan norir ledger at gate 8016 under passcode 755406

Handover for the Bramleyfort password reset revamp. The new flow replaces emailed links with short-lived codes; rate limiting lives in ResetGate middleware, and token hashing moved to the Larkspur helper. Tests cover expiry, reuse, and enumeration. Outstanding: the audit-log event names need review before merge, and the staging feature flag is still off. To unlock the shared credentials vault for the staging run, the recovery passphrase is below.

vault phrase of yadup-hahog = kasax-goriel-olidor-novmir-istax-olimir-sorys-olimir-holeth-aldeth-ralax-zordor-ralion-wenax

Hiring Freeze — Delvane Division (Managers Only)

Effective immediately, all open requisitions in the Delvane division are frozen. Offers already extended stand; everything else is paused pending the Q4 reforecast. Sales leads: do not promise account teams additional headcount, and route backfill exceptions to Orla Vance. Contractor conversions are included in the freeze. Internal transfers into Delvane require VP sign-off. Expect a decision on resumption within six weeks. The reasoning is summarized in the note below.

internal memo for kawip-hadug: Headcount on the Wenwyn team goes from 7 to 140 by the end of January. Gross margin on Wenwyn came in at 20 percent against a plan of 15 percent.

**Ticket: Clarify dependency pinning policy for Brackenshore services**

Several Brackenshore services still use floating minor versions, which caused last week's transitive breakage in the billing worker. Proposal: pin exact versions everywhere, with a weekly automated bump PR reviewed by the owning team. Lockfiles become mandatory in CI. Exceptions require a written waiver. The CI run demonstrating the breakage carries the token below.

pipeline stamp: htk9_ce63042d9